On 17.04.2025 13:23, Jürgen Groß wrote: On 17.04.25 12:06, Alexey wrote:On 17.04.2025 11:51, Juergen Gross wrote:On 17.04.25 10:45, Alexey wrote:On 17.04.2025 10:12, Jürgen Groß wrote:On 17.04.25 09:00, Alexey wrote:On 17.04.2025 03:58, Jakub Kicinski wrote:Do you mean that it would be better to move the get_page(pdata) call lower, after checking for NULL in xdpf, so that the reference count is only increasedOn Mon, 14 Apr 2025 18:34:01 +0000 Alexey Nepomnyashih wrote:get_page(pdata);Please notice this get_page() here.xdpf = xdp_convert_buff_to_frame(xdp); + if (unlikely(!xdpf)) { + trace_xdp_exception(queue->info->netdev, prog, act); + break; + }after a successful conversion?I think the error handling here is generally broken (or at least very questionable).I suspect that in case of at least some errors the get_page() is leakingeven without this new patch. In case I'm wrong a comment reasoning why there is no leak should be added. JuergenI think pdata is freed in xdp_return_frame_rx_napi() -> __xdp_return()Agreed. But what if xennet_xdp_xmit() returns an error < 0? In this case xdp_return_frame_rx_napi() won't be called. JuergenAgreed. There is no explicit freed pdata in the calling function xennet_get_responses(). Without this, the page referenced by pdata could be leaked. I suggest:Could you please merge the two if () blocks, as they share the call of xdp_return_frame_rx_napi() now? Something like: if (unlikely(err <= 0)) { if (err < 0) trace_xdp_exception(queue->info->netdev, prog, act); xdp_return_frame_rx_napi(xdpf); } Juergen P.S.: please don't use HTML in emails I can't do this because xennet_xdp_xmit() can return a value > 0
